Year End Legislative Update

This week, the Senate and Assembly held leadership votes for their respective houses, and both houses reelected their current leadership. In the Senate, Senator Andrea Stewart-Cousins was reelected as Majority Leader while Senator Rob Ortt was reelected as Minority Leader. In the Assembly, Assemblymember Carl Heastie was reelected as Speaker while Assemblymember Will Barclay was reelected as Minority Leader. These leadership reelections will not become finalized until the new session convenes and a vote of the newly elected members in both houses is held on the floor. This vote will take place the first day of the legislative session, Wednesday, January 4, 2023.

Several of the legislative races are still undergoing a hand recount, but all should be officially decided by December 15. There will be no announcement regarding committee chairs or other leadership roles before this process concludes in either house. We anticipate that the information on new committee chairs will not be released until the end of December at the earliest. We do not anticipate that the legislature will return until January 4th, but there are rumors circulating that the legislature could reconvene sooner than that to vote on a legislative pay raise. For a pay raise to take effect for the 2023 legislative session, the current legislature has to vote to approve it by December 31. If this does not happen, the earliest a new pay raise could take effect is January 1, 2025. The prospect of a return to vote on a pay raise also raises the possibility that the legislature could take up other issues if they were to return. Governor Kathy Hochul’s inauguration will take place on Sunday, January 1, 2023 in Albany. She will hold her first State of the State address on Tuesday, January 10, where she will outline her priorities and agenda for the upcoming session. Her first proposed budget is due by February 1, 2023, and we anticipate that her budget presentation outlining her budget will take place in late January.
